First ICC trial addressing Darfur war crimes to open - Reuters.com

First ICC trial addressing Darfur war crimes to open - Reuters.com | Backstabber Watch | Scoop.it

The first trial addressing atrocities in Darfur opens at the International Criminal Court on Tuesday, nearly 20 years after the Sudanese region was racked by widespread violence that left hundreds of thousands dead.
